Transaction 57e475996bcc402e2432f7e0ecd7ff801f663d3372c7fbdb654d7168653c6050

3 Input
2 Outputs
  • 57e475996bcc402e2432f7e0ecd7ff801f663d3372c7fbdb654d7168653c6050:0
  • value  190000000
    address  17PoCzfCjfzv4v1WAN8MMNRfFtr4vUmt9i
  • 57e475996bcc402e2432f7e0ecd7ff801f663d3372c7fbdb654d7168653c6050:1
  • value  169717622
    address  1Pnn96PRV81izCboUEJX8sWQHH3qjc1uhs